Job Description
Company: Flow Control Group
About Us:
Flow Control Group (FCG) is a leading provider of fluid handling, process, and industrial automation solutions across North America. We are a 100% employee-owned organization made up of over 2,000 team members and 95+ entrepreneurial brands—each empowered to think big, move fast, and bring innovative ideas to life. Our ownership mindset fuels a culture of pride, accountability, and exceptional customer service.
At FCG, we believe in the power of partnership and entrepreneurship. We work collaboratively across our brands to drive growth, unlock new opportunities, and deliver real impact for our customers. This unique model allows us to combine local expertise with national strength, creating a dynamic environment where creativity meets practicality.
Visit our website: https://flowcontrolgroup.com/
The MuleSoft Integrations Developer is responsible for designing, developing, and implementing integration solutions using the MuleSoft Anypoint Platform. This role ensures seamless connectivity between enterprise systems, applications, and third-party services to optimize business processes and enhance operational efficiency. The position involves leading integration projects, mentoring junior developers, and enforcing best practices for API-led connectivity.
Key Responsibilities
• Integration Design & Development
◦ Architect and implement integrations using MuleSoft Anypoint Platform
◦ Develop APIs and data transformations to connect P21 Cloud with enterprise and third-party systems.
◦ Design and maintain scalable integration solutions between internal and external platforms
◦ Build APIs using RAML/REST/SOAP and implement MuleSoft best practices.
◦ Configure and manage CloudHub deployments, Runtime Manager, and API Manager.
• API Lifecycle Management
◦ Oversee full API lifecycle: design, development, testing, deployment, monitoring, and optimization.
◦ Create reusable API assets and connectors for scalability and faster development.
• Collaboration & Leadership
◦ Work closely with architects, business analysts, and cross-functional teams to define integration requirements.
◦ Mentor junior developers and enforce coding standards and integration best practices.
• Performance & Troubleshooting
◦ Monitor integration performance and health; troubleshoot and resolve issues.
◦ Optimize integration processes for efficiency and scalability.
• Documentation & Compliance
◦ Develop and maintain technical documentation, including integration specifications and data flow diagrams.
◦ Ensure adherence to security standards and compliance requirements.
Required Qualifications
• Education: Bachelor’s degree in Computer Science, Information Technology, or related field.
• Experience:
◦ 10+ years IT experience with 5+ years in MuleSoft development.
◦ 5+ years of experience integrating ERP systems, preferably Epicor Prophet 21 Cloud
◦ Experience integrating Epicor P21 Cloud API’s with Salesforce, banking platforms, eCommerce, or data warehouses
◦ Hands-on experience with MuleSoft Anypoint Studio, CloudHub, API Manager, and related tools.
• Technical Skills:
◦ Experience with EDI, ETL, and flat file integrations.
◦ Expertise in API-led connectivity, ESB architecture, and integration patterns.
◦ Experience integrating MuleSoft with Salesforce and other enterprise systems.
• Certifications: MuleSoft Certified Developer (MCD-Level 1) required; Architect-level certifications preferred.
• Other Skills:
◦ Strong problem-solving and analytical skills.
◦ Excellent communication and collaboration abilities.
◦ Experience in Agile/Scrum environments.
Preferred Skills
• Experience integrating Epicor P21 Cloud with Salesforce, banking platforms, eCommerce, or data warehouses.
• Knowledge of DevOps practices and CI/CD pipelines.
• Familiarity with tools like Git, Jira, and Confluence.
• Experience migrating legacy integrations to MuleSoft.
• Integration Experience
◦ Hands-on experience integrating with ERP systems (Epicor P21, SAP, Oracle, Business Central), CRM (Salesforce), and other enterprise apps.
◦ Knowledge of ETL tools and data transformation techniques, like Mulesoft, Boomi, Celigo, Microsoft Power Automate, Compratio, or other service provider tools.
◦ .NET or Python scripting experience is a plus.
◦ Knowledge of data security and compliance best practices.
#flowcontrolgroup
#manycompaniesoneteam
#FCG-m
#LI-KE
Why Build a Career with Us?
Everyone’s an Owner of the Company: Because every team member contributes to Flow Control Group’s success, everyone has the benefits of ownership! Flow Control Group has a broad-based employee ownership program extended to every employee within our portfolio companies.
Competitive Benefits: Enjoy an attractive benefits package that includes Medical, Dental and Vision insurance (among other plans), competitive 401(k) matching program, career growth opportunities, employee referral program, paid time off and holidays, as well as parental leave.
Training: FCG University learning and training platform available to all employees offering over 80k courses.
Career Growth Opportunities: At Flow Control Group, we are committed to your professional development. With a vast network of over 100 brands across North America, we provide unparalleled opportunities for growth and advancement. Whether you're just starting your career or looking to take it to the next level, we offer custom training programs, mentorship, and a supportive environment to help you achieve your goals. Join us and be part of a dynamic team where your contributions make a real impact.
Equal Opportunity Employer: Flow Control Group is an Equal Opportunity Employer. We celebrate diversity and are committed to creating an inclusive environment for all employees.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, or any other legally protected characteristics.